Top definition
screwboo - any injury a person can get from rough or playful sex.
Geez, did you see the wicked screwboo on her knees? I don't think I'd wear shorts after getting a carpet burn like that. Next time she has sex on the carpet, she needs to wear knee pads!
by Ruby Slippers March 16, 2010
